  1. All You Need to Know About QuickBooks Unexpected error QuickBooks unexpected error is the most annoying error that users face while working on the accounting application. Just like the name, the error shows up unexpectedly on the screen. This error is seen on various QuickBooks versions, including QuickBooks Point of Sale. Sometimes, it appears while installing POS programs, accessing company file on QuickBooks, and opening other QuickBooks programs.   2. What are the causes behind unexpected error in QuickBooks? Before you move on to the troubleshooting section, check out the list of factors given below that trigger the error: User account does not have sufficient permissions to access the QuickBooks company file in multi-user mode. Utilizing an old update of QuickBooks Desktop. Improper network connection between company files stored on server and workstation. Corruption in the QuickBooks company file. The workstation is infected by the attack of a virus or malware. Now that you have understood what evokes the error, fix it permanently by following the solutions discussed below.

  4. Solution 1. Create QuickBooks company file user again Open the QuickBooks Desktop application and select the Company tab. Click Users and then the Setup Users and Roles option. Go to the User List, choose the user and click Delete. Click Yes to confirm the deletion. Now, create a new user by following the steps given below: Move to the Users and Roles page and click New. Create a new username for the new user and type your password. Confirm the password and set roles for the user.

  5. Solution 2. Download the newly released update of the QuickBooks program Close company files open in QB and then exit the QuickBooks Desktop application. Select the Windows Start menu, search for QuickBooks, and right-click it. Select the Run as administrator option and wait till the No Company Open screen opens. Go to the Help menu and choose Update QuickBooks Desktop. Click on the Options tab, then Mark All, and then the Save button. Click the Update Now tab and then mark the Reset Update checkbox. To start the download, click Get Updates and reopen QuickBooks. Complete the installation and reboot your computer.

  6. Solution 3. Fix damaged company file and network by running File Doctor from the QuickBooks Tool Hub You need to close company files and exit QuickBooks to use the QuickBooks Tool Hub. From your web browser, download the newly released version of QuickBooks Tool Hub on your computer. Save the QuickBooksToolHub.exe file to an easily accessible location on your workstation. Open the file and follow the on-screen instructions. Select the agree to the terms and conditions checkbox to install QuickBooks Tool Hub completely. Look for the QuickBooks Tool Hub icon on the desktop once the installation finishes. Double-click the QuickBooks Tool Hub icon to open it, and then choose Company File Issues. Click Run QuickBooks File Doctor, scroll the drop-down menu, and select your company file. If you can’t see your company file in the drop-down, click Browse and search. Next, select the middle Check your file option, and click Continue. Enter QuickBooks admin login credentials when prompted and click Next. Wait till the tool scans the file, then open QuickBooks and sign in to the company file.

  7. Solution 4. Disable UAC on Windows Click the Windows Start button and from the right panel, select and open Control Panel. Search and select User Account and then click Change User Account Control settings. Drag the slider to Never Notify to and click Yes to turn on User Account Control (UAC) settings on Windows. Click OK, restart your computer, and open QuickBooks.

  8. Solution 5. Fix the issue by repairing QuickBooks manually Restart your computer and select the Windows icon on your desktop. Scroll the list of all programs, choose Control Panel, and open it. Select Programs and Features, then click Uninstall a Program. Pick QuickBooks from the list of programs and click Uninstall/Change. Select Continue, Next, and then click Repair. When the repair completes, click Finish.

  9. Solution 6. Execute clean installation of the QuickBooks Desktop application Open the QuickBooks account management portal and note down the QuickBooks product information such as product year, QuickBooks version, and license number. Open your web browser and download the installer for your version of QuickBooks. Uninstall QuickBooks completely from your workstation by following the steps given below: 1. Click on the Windows icon on your desktop, then select and open Control Panel. 2. Select Programs and Features, scroll the list of programs and highlight the QuickBooks Desktop version you want to uninstall. 3. Click Uninstall/Change and then select Remove. Now, install QuickBooks Desktop using the new installer file.

  10. Solution 7. Allow File Share Access Open File Explorer and open the QuickBooks folder. Right-click the QuickBooks folder, choose Properties, and go to the Sharing menu.
